Hashimoto City

Hashimoto is the gateway to Koyasan, dotted with historic roads and temples and shrines, and is a quiet town full of natural and religious attractions.

Wakayama City

Wakayama City is a thriving castle town centered around Wakayama Castle, the gateway to the Kii Peninsula, a diverse tourist city where you can enjoy the sea, history, and hot springs.

Totsugawa Village

Totsugawa Village is the largest village in Japan, where you can enjoy suspension bridges, hot springs, and the Kumano Kodo. It is a town where you can experience the dynamic charm of nature and history.
